单词 sensu lato
释义

sensu latoadv.

Brit. /ˌsɛnsuː ˈlɑːtəʊ/, U.S. /ˌsɛnsu ˈlɑ(ˌ)toʊ/, /ˌsɛnsu ˈleɪ(ˌ)toʊ/
Origin: A borrowing from Latin. Etymon: Latin sensu lato.
Etymology: < post-classical Latin sensu lato in the broad sense (1755 or earlier) < classical Latin sensū , ablative of sensus sense n. + lātō , ablative of lātus broad (see late adj.2), after post-classical Latin sensu latiore ‘in a broader sense’ (1604 or earlier; also latiore sensu (8th cent. in a British source)). Compare sensu stricto adv.Compare the following slightly earlier example of post-classical Latin sensu latiore in an English context:1848 Jurist 25 Nov. 492/1 Equivalent to the ‘dominium’ sensu latiore of the classical jurists.
Broadly speaking; in the broad sense (of a term, esp. in the natural sciences). Opposed to sensu stricto adv.

sensu lato1849
1849 P. M. de Colquhoun Summ. Rom. Civil Law I. ii. iii. 364 The patricians, then, sensu stricto, implied the old hereditary noble by birth; sensu lato, it included also the later noble by creation.
1896 Q. Jrnl. Geol. Soc. 52 542 To this Tithonic stage corresponds in Southern England the Portland stage sensu lato.
1940 Lancet 3 Aug. 141/1 Every agent of a transmissible disease will be called a virus (sensu lato).
1973 B. J. Williams Evol. & Human Origins xi. 176 In the material that follows I shall use the term Neandertal sensu lato, that is, in the broad sense.
2006 K. D. Rose Beginning Age Mammals vii. 94 Some of the higher taxa that are discussed here were formerly assigned to the Insectivora sensu lato.
